Faysal Bank & SBP Introduce New Affordable Housing Initiative Mera Ghar Mera Ashiana – Apply Now
In a major step towards home ownership for low and middle-income families, Faysal Bank Limited (FBL) in collaboration with the State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) has launched a new Affordable Housing Finance Scheme under the name “Mera Ghar Mera Ashiana”.
This initiative aims to make owning a home easier, faster, and more affordable for citizens who have long struggled with high property prices and limited financing options.
Through this scheme, eligible applicants can apply for housing finance of up to Rs. 10 million at low markup rates with flexible repayment plans extending up to 20 years.
The goal is simple — to ensure that every Pakistani family can build or buy their dream home with the support of modern, Shariah-compliant financing.
What Is the ‘Mera Ghar Mera Ashiana’ Program?
The Mera Ghar Mera Ashiana Program is part of SBP’s ongoing commitment to promote financial inclusion and affordable home financing across Pakistan.
It specifically targets:
-
Low and middle-income families earning between Rs. 30,000 to Rs. 200,000 per month
-
People who don’t currently own a house
-
Citizens wanting to construct, purchase, or renovate a house
Faysal Bank, being Pakistan’s largest Islamic retail bank, has partnered with SBP to provide Shariah-compliant home financing under this program.
The scheme is available across urban and semi-urban areas, including Lahore, Karachi, Islamabad, Faisalabad, Multan, and Peshawar.
Key Features and Benefits of the Scheme
| Feature | Details |
|---|---|
| Loan Amount | Up to Rs. 10 million |
| Markup Rate | 2% to 9% (subsidized by SBP) |
| Tenure | 5 to 20 years |
| Financing Type | Shariah-compliant diminishing Musharakah |
| Purpose | Purchase, construction, or renovation |
| Eligibility | Salaried, self-employed, or informal income earners |
| Property Type | Apartment, house, or plot-based construction |
| Collateral | The property being financed |
The program includes three income-based tiers, with varying loan sizes and SBP subsidies ensuring that even lower-income families can qualify.
Who Can Apply for Mera Ghar Mera Ashiana?
You can apply for this scheme if you:
-
Are a Pakistani citizen aged between 25–60 years.
-
Have a stable income source (salaried or self-employed).
-
Do not already own a residential property anywhere in Pakistan.
-
Are looking to buy a house/apartment, construct a new home, or renovate your existing home.
-
Meet the credit assessment criteria set by Faysal Bank and SBP.
The program is designed to ensure that even first-time homebuyers with limited savings can finally become homeowners.

Documents Required for Application
-
Copy of CNIC (applicant and co-applicant, if any)
-
Salary certificate or business proof (for self-employed)
-
Bank statement (last 6 months)
-
Property documents or purchase agreement
-
Utility bill (for address verification)
The documentation process is paper-light, fully digitized, and verified using NADRA Smart ID for speed and security.

Impact on Economy and Construction Sector
Economists predict that this initiative will not only help individuals but also stimulate Pakistan’s economy by reviving the construction and real estate sectors.
With easier access to home financing, demand for building materials, labor, and allied industries will rise — generating thousands of new jobs across the country.
